Guy Fawkes Night falls every year on 5 November, marking the failed Gunpowder Plot of 1605, when Guy Fawkes and his fellow conspirators tried to blow up the British Parliament and assassinate King James I. British settlers brought the tradition to New Zealand in the 19th century, and today it's a community celebration rather than a political one. It isn't a public holiday — businesses, schools and offices run as normal — so the celebrating happens after dark.

Know the Local Rules Before You Light Anything

Private backyard fireworks are still common around New Zealand on 5 November, but some councils have regulated or discouraged them over safety, noise and environmental concerns — and the push is firmly toward public displays. If you're visiting, the public celebration is both the easier and the more sociable option: you get the full show without the clean-up, and you're standing where the community is.
